Questions marquées «integer»

26
Suis-je un numéro «redivosite»?

Redivosite est un mot-valise inventé dans le seul but de ce défi. C'est un mélange de réduction, de division et de composite. Définition Étant donné un entier N> 6 : Si N est premier, N n'est pas un nombre de redivosite. Si N est composite: calculer à plusieurs reprises N '= N / d + d + 1...

26
Est-ce un nombre entier?

Un nombre est entier s'il s'agit d'un entier non négatif sans partie décimale. Donc , 0et 8et 233494.0sont tout, tout 1.1et 0.001et 233494.999ne sont pas. Contribution Un nombre à virgule flottante dans la base / l'encodage par défaut de votre langue. Par exemple, la représentation entière par...

26
Sortie avec la même longueur toujours

Avec des défis comme Output avec la même longueur que le code et Create output deux fois la longueur du code , j'ai pensé à un défi séparé, mais similaire. La tâche consiste à produire une sortie. Il peut s'agir d'une chaîne, d'une liste de caractères ou du format de sortie par défaut de votre...

26
Sortie des heures à 90 degrés

Aujourd'hui, en jouant avec mes enfants, j'ai remarqué qu'un jouet apparemment simple dans le parc cachait un défi. La roue a un triangle qui pointe vers un nombre, mais aussi trois cercles qui pointent vers les nombres tous les 90 degrés par rapport au premier. Alors: Défi (vraiment simple) Étant...

26
Dureté numérique des nombres entiers

Pour trouver la dureté numérique d'un entier, prenez sa représentation binaire et comptez le nombre de fois où un début et un retour 1peuvent être supprimés jusqu'à ce qu'il commence ou se termine par a 0. Le nombre total de bits supprimés est sa dureté numérique. C'est une explication assez...

26
Le défi des produits numériques non nuls

A l'origine la racine numérique multiplicative Défi Faites essentiellement ce que dit le titre Méthode Étant donné un entier positif 1 <= N <= 100000000 via l'une de nos méthodes de saisie standard , multipliez chaque chiffre ensemble, en ignorant les zéros. Ex: Prenez un nombre, dites...

26
Numéros composites résistants au bitflip

Parfois, lors de l'écriture d'un programme, vous devez utiliser un nombre premier pour une raison ou une autre (par exemple, la cryptographie). Je suppose que parfois, vous devez également utiliser un numéro composite. Parfois, au moins ici sur PPCG, votre programme doit être capable de gérer des...

26
Pigeonhole Principe & Code Golf

Le principe du pigeonhole stipule que Si N articles sont placés dans M cases, avec N > M , alors au moins une case doit contenir plus d'un article. Pour beaucoup, ce principe a un statut spécial par rapport à d'autres propositions mathématiques. Comme l'a écrit EW Dijkstra , Il est entouré d'une...

26
Une infinité de nombres premiers

Depuis Euclide, nous savons qu'il existe une infinité de nombres premiers. L'argument est en contradiction: S'il n'y a que nombre fini, disons que p1,p2,...,pnp1,p2,...,pnp_1,p_2,...,p_n , alors sûrement m:=p1⋅p2⋅...⋅pn+1m:=p1⋅p2⋅...⋅pn+1m:=p_1\cdot p_2\cdot...\cdot p_n+1 n'est divisible par aucun...

26
Quelle est la longueur de mon numéro?

Défi Étant donné un entier, Qdans la plage -(2^100) ≤ Q ≤ 2^100, affichez le nombre de chiffres de ce nombre (en base 10). Règles Oui, vous pouvez prendre le nombre sous forme de chaîne et trouver sa longueur. Toutes les fonctions mathématiques sont autorisées. Vous pouvez prendre une entrée dans...

25
Combien de jours dans un mois?

Étant donné une représentation textuelle (nom complet insensible à la casse ou abréviation à 3 caractères) d'un mois, renvoyer le nombre de jours du mois. Par exemple, december, DECet decdevraient tous revenir 31. Février peut avoir 28 ou 29 jours. Supposons que l'entrée est un mois sous l'une des...

25
Grands gros chiffres

Tout en essayant de jouer plusieurs de mes réponses, j'ai dû écrire de grands nombres entiers en aussi peu de caractères que possible. Maintenant, je connais la meilleure façon de le faire: je vais vous faire écrire ce programme. Le défi Écrivez un programme qui, lorsqu'il reçoit un entier positif,...

25
Énumération entière étourdie

Votre défi aujourd'hui est de produire un terme donné d'une séquence énumérant tous les entiers. La séquence est la suivante: si nous avons une fonction indexée sur 0 qui génère la séquence f(n)et ceil(x)est la fonction plafond, alors f(0) = 0; abs(f(n)) = ceil(n/2); sign(f(n))est positif lorsque...

25
Dépendances triangulaires

Un nombre triangulaire est un nombre qui est la somme des nnombres naturels de 1 à n. Par exemple, 1 + 2 + 3 + 4 = 10il en 10va de même pour un nombre triangulaire. Étant donné un entier positif ( 0 < n <= 10000) en entrée (peut être pris comme un entier ou comme une chaîne), retournez le...

25
Concevons une mosaïque de chiffres

Défi Etant donné un nombre entier positif NNN , répéter chacun de ses chiffres d1,d2,d3,⋯,dnd1,d2,d3,⋯,dnd_1, d_2, d_3, \cdots, d_n un nombre de fois correspondant à sa position dans NNN . En d'autres termes, chaque chiffre dkdkd_k doit être répété kkk fois (pour chaque 1≤k≤n1≤k≤n1\le k\le n ,...

25
Listes entières de Noé

Introduction: Je pense que nous en avons tous entendu parler, mais voici un très bref résumé: Noé a rassemblé deux de chaque espèce animale sur la planète, mâle et femelle, pour sauver dans son arche lors d'une grande inondation. La citation réelle de la Bible est: Genèse 7: 2-3 Vous devez emporter...

25
Substitution de chaîne récursive

La tâche Ecrivez un programme ou une fonction qui, à partir de trois chaînes, A, B, Cproduit une chaîne de sortie dans laquelle chaque instance de Bin Aa été récursivement remplacée par C. Substituer récursivement signifie répéter une substitution où à chaque étape toutes les instances non...